This little puzzle made it into my shortlist of six GoAnywhere puzzles because of the pretty corner details and because this is a favourite painting. The shaped edge certainly added to the difficulty for me. 160pc, measuring only 6.5 x 7.5in, with six whimsies, it is laser-cut from plywood. This is quite a contrast to Grafika's 2000pc version, completed recently by Piecefull.

 

This is John Singer Sargent's 'Carnation, Lily, Lily, Rose' of 1885-6 which is in the collection of Tate Britain (and also featured in the recent Sargent exhibition at the National Portrait Gallery, jointly organised with the NY Met, 'Sargent Portraits of Artists and Friends').

 

The puzzle colours are a little on the green side - the original painting is very beautiful.
